Founded in 1996, the Association of Sites Advocating Child Protection (ASACP) 
is a non-profit organization dedicated to eliminating child pornography from 
the Internet. ASACP also works to help parents prevent children from viewing 
pornograghic material online.
   
  WHAT THEY DO
  1. They provide an online hotline for people to report suspected online child 
pornogragphy.
  2. Created the RTA "Restricted to Adults." This is a label to help parents 
filter there interenet use.
